Distance between Cornwall ON and Laurier-Station QC

The distance from Cornwall to Laurier-Station is 319 kilometers by road including 313 kilometers on motorways. Road takes approximately 3 hours and 20 minutes and goes through Montreal, Longueuil, Drummondville, Sainte-Anne-de-Bellevue, Baie-d'Urfé, Beaconsfield and Kirkland.

How far is Cornwall to Laurier-Station by land?

The distance between Cornwall and Laurier-Station is 319 km by road including 313 km on motorways.

Precise satellite coordinates of highways were used for this calculation. The start and finish points are the centers of Cornwall and Laurier-Station respectively.

How far is Cornwall to Laurier-Station by plane?

The shortest distance (air line, as the crow flies) between Cornwall and Laurier-Station is 294 km.

This distance is calculated using the Haversine formula as a great-circle distance between two points on the surface of a sphere. The start and finish points are the centers of Cornwall and Laurier-Station respectively. Actual distance between airports may be different.

Where is Cornwall in relation to Laurier-Station?

Cornwall is located 294 km south-west of Laurier-Station.

Cornwall has geographic coordinates: latitude 45.02137, longitude -74.73176.

Laurier-Station has geographic coordinates: latitude 46.54021, longitude -71.63292.
